Transaction 12a7591bf224b631eedb087ef497e1dfd32a40b4686166add15e8e58e017f74c

1 Input
2 Outputs
  • 12a7591bf224b631eedb087ef497e1dfd32a40b4686166add15e8e58e017f74c:0
  • value  193000
    address  33UgaPh7gVmjkyYGbLg7PD9TnZCC7fihvf
  • 12a7591bf224b631eedb087ef497e1dfd32a40b4686166add15e8e58e017f74c:1
  • value  246400
    address  1NDdojyZ86vzyLfxrUPNrfbn8ZutD7uSzn